The Allen Institute is launching a new accelerator on human brain health and disease. This initiative aims to dramatically accelerate our understanding of human brain structure and function, identify the molecular, cellular and circuit basis of disease progression, and pioneer new therapeutic strategies targeting vulnerable and affected cell types. Our mission focuses on taking a human-centric approach to understanding and treating disease, combining a large-scale open science discovery approach across multiple diseases, AI-based disease modeling, and translational programs in specific diseases to move from discovery to clinical application. We aim to make transformational change in understanding and treating brain disorders, the biggest health challenge of our time. The Associate Director, Assay Development and Process Engineering, will play a key leadership role within the organization, leading a team to develop and implement scalable high-information content assays that meet the needs of large-scale data generation pipelines for single cell molecular and spatially-resolved analysis of brain tissues or other biological samples. Reporting to the Executive Director, Strategy and Scientific Operations, the successful candidate will be highly experienced in industry‑standard assay development, and motivated to work in a team environment with laboratory scientists and managers, engineers, and computational scientists to develop robust pipelines to generate large‑scale datasets for scientific discovery. This role will be responsible for supporting internal scientists’ needs and staying at the forefront of technological innovation in relevant domains, managing a portfolio of technology development and implementation goals and working with similar functions across scientific units.
